1990 Plymouth Sundance vs. 2005 Volvo V70
To start off, 2005 Volvo V70 is newer by 15 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1990 Plymouth Sundance.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1990 Plymouth Sundance would be higher. At 2,435 cc (5 cylinders), 2005 Volvo V70 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Volvo V70 (257 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 161 more horse power than 1990 Plymouth Sundance. (96 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Volvo V70 should accelerate faster than 1990 Plymouth Sundance.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Volvo V70 weights approximately 450 kg more than 1990 Plymouth Sundance.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
